For me it was a matter of noticing that I was feeling cruddy, then stopping to consider the things I was telling myself at the time.
I think this is a good point made by PButton. Perhaps you could carry a small notebook with you so that for every strong emotion you have throughout the day you can jot down these feelings and the emotions or triggers behind it that lead you to feeling that way. Then, you could possibly consider why you feel that way and the core belief that lies behind said reaction.
